Sippin’ & Stitchin’
has one goal to spread our love for the textile arts in a fun, accessible way
After a few curious friends asked to learn, Lea hosted wine and stitch nights on her living room floor. After realizing how much she enjoyed hosting events, Sippin’ & Stitchin’ was born and we went on to formally host and collaborate with local spots. Since then, we’ve continue to expand to other major cities across the US. We can’t believe that we get to share what we love and call it our job!Whether we’re creating a wall hanging, custom-stitched patches or up-cycling clothing, S&S aims to harness creativity in a fun, laid-back environment where all feel welcome. We offer public and private events as well as beginner-friendly kits and supplies.
Lea Saccomanno is a multidisciplinary textile artist as well as the owner of Sippin’ & Stitchin’. Originally taught by her grandmother, she’s been practicing for over fifteen years.
